Understanding the Technical Framework
The Drum Cyclonic Barrel Portable Incinerator sets itself apart from conventional models through its remarkable engineering. This dual-chamber incineration system utilizes cyclonic burn technology, ensuring optimal thermal efficiency and complete combustion of waste materials. The internal refractory lining is designed to withstand high temperatures while minimizing damage and prolonging the equipment’s life.
One of the key features of this portable incinerator is its air transportability, allowing it to be deployed quickly in remote areas or during emergencies. The compact design not only facilitates easy transportation but also ensures rapid set-up and efficiency even in challenging geographical locations.
Practical Applications of the Drum Incinerator
Implementing the Drum Cyclonic Barrel Portable Incinerator can revolutionize waste management practices across various settings:
- Disaster Response Units: In the wake of natural disasters, such as hurricanes and earthquakes, humanitarian organizations frequently face the challenge of managing increased waste. The portable incinerator can be rapidly deployed to incinerate medical waste, organic debris, and hazardous materials, thus preventing further health risks.
- Remote Healthcare Facilities: Healthcare centers in rural areas often struggle with the disposal of biohazardous waste such as surgical by-products or human tissues. This unit provides a reliable solution, ensuring compliance with health regulations while safeguarding the surrounding environment.
